Material Durability and Quality
Choosing a premium fishing rod and reel combo means prioritizing materials that can withstand tough conditions and frequent use. I look for corrosion-resistant elements like stainless steel, graphite, or composite alloys, which hold up against saltwater and harsh environments. Durable guides with ceramic or stainless steel rings are essential for preventing line fraying and ensuring smooth casting over time. The reel’s construction should include reinforced frames, sealed bearings, and sturdy metal components like aluminum or brass to resist wear and repeated stress. For the rod itself, materials like carbon fiber or IM6 graphite provide strength, flexibility, and longevity, especially under heavy loads. In high-quality combos, each component is tested for impact resistance and fatigue, guaranteeing consistent, durable performance during extended fishing sessions.
Casting and Line Capacity
The effectiveness of a premium fishing combo depends heavily on its casting ability and line capacity. The rod’s length, power, and flexibility directly impact how far and accurately you can cast, which is vital for reaching distant fish. Line capacity, measured in yards or meters at specific pound-test ratings, determines how much line the reel can hold, affecting long-distance casting and trolling efficiency. The reel’s spool size and retrieval speed also influence how quickly you can reel in slack or a catch, making your overall experience smoother. High-quality guides with ceramic or stainless-steel rings reduce friction, allowing for longer, more accurate casts without tangles. Choosing a line type and weight compatible with the combo ensures peak performance and minimizes line breakage during long casts.
Power and Action Type
Selecting the right power and action type is essential because they directly impact how well your rod handles different fish and lures. Power rating indicates the rod’s lifting strength, ranging from ultralight to heavy, which determines its suitability for various fish sizes. Action type describes where the rod bends under load; fast action rods bend mainly at the tip, offering sensitivity and control. Medium and medium-light actions provide a good balance, making them versatile for different scenarios. Heavy power rods are built for larger, stronger fish and heavier lures, providing maximum backbone. The combination of power and action influences casting distance, accuracy, and your ability to fight fish effectively. Choosing correctly ensures better performance and a more successful fishing experience.
Reel Smoothness and Bearings
When evaluating premium fishing reel and rod combos, reel smoothness and bearing quality are essential for a seamless angling experience. The number and quality of ball bearings directly affect how fluid the reel operates. Reels with five or more stainless steel or ceramic bearings provide smoother retrieval and casting, reducing fatigue during long sessions. Sealed bearings are a big plus—they keep dirt, water, and debris out, ensuring consistent performance and lowering maintenance. Anti-reverse bearings also play a key role by enabling instant hook sets and preventing handle back play. The material of the bearings, such as stainless steel or ceramic, influences durability and corrosion resistance, especially in saltwater environments. Overall, investing in high-quality bearings results in a more reliable, smooth, and enjoyable fishing experience.

Target Species Compatibility
Matching your fishing gear to your target species is essential for success. First, check that the combo’s line and lure weight ratings match the typical size and behavior of the fish you’re after. If you’re targeting larger, stronger species, guarantee the reel’s drag capacity can handle their fighting strength without breaking. The rod’s action—fast, medium, or slow—should align with your preferred techniques, whether trolling, casting, or bottom fishing. Length and power matter too; they help you reach the right zones and handle the fish size. Finally, verify that guides and the reel seat are compatible with your line type, ensuring smooth line flow and durability. Proper compatibility guarantees your gear performs at its best when it counts.

What Are the Maintenance Tips for High-End Fishing Combos?
To keep my high-end fishing combos in top shape, I regularly rinse them with fresh water after each trip, especially if I’ve been in saltwater. I also check the guides and reel for any damage or dirt, then lubricate moving parts with quality oil. Storing them in a cool, dry place and avoiding prolonged exposure to sunlight helps prevent wear and prolongs their lifespan.

How Does Rod Length Influence Casting Distance and Accuracy?
Rod length really impacts your casting distance and accuracy. A longer rod generally lets me cast farther because it leverages more power, especially useful for reaching distant fish. However, it can be trickier to control, making precise casts harder. Shorter rods give me better accuracy and control in tight spots or when I need pinpoint precision. I choose my rod length based on the fishing environment and my skill level to optimize both distance and accuracy.
